Stimulant
A type of drug that increases activity in the nervous system, leading to increased alertness, attention, and energy.
Euphoria
A state of intense happiness and self-confidence, sometimes artificially induced by the use of drugs or when experiencing certain psychological states.
Recreational Drug
Substances taken for enjoyment, rather than for medical reasons, which can alter perceptions, feelings, or consciousness.
Psychological Dependence
A form of dependence characterized by emotional–mental cravings for a substance or behavior, often in the absence of physical dependency.
